Onboarding note for the Ledgerpane admin table: bulk edits are applied through the batcher service, not directly against the database. Select rows, choose an action, and the batcher stages changes in a pending set you can review before commit. Edits over 500 rows require a second approver — this is enforced server-side, so don't try to chunk around it. To run the batcher locally you need the staging write credential, which goes in your .env as the next line.

secret setting of bahip-kagag: RELAY_SECRET3=c83

Runbook: account recovery for the Torvale firmware update channel. Support handles this when the channel publisher account is locked, usually after failed signing attempts on a Brindlet device rollout. First confirm no firmware push is mid-flight in the Torvale console; interrupting an active push can brick enrolled devices. Then suspend the channel, clear the pending signing jobs, and open the recovery flow from the publisher settings page. Document the lockout cause in the shift log. The recovery flow prompts for the passphrase shown below.

strongbox words: norwyn-wenael-aldvan-aldiel-wendor-holael

Subject: Config hot-reload — quick notes

Hey Priya,

Welcome to the Lanternfish rotation. Quick heads-up before your first shift: the gateway hot-reloads config from the Cinderbank store every 30s. Bad values are rejected and the last-good snapshot stays active, so a broken push won't page you immediately — watch the reload-failure counter instead. Never restart the pods to force a reload; that drops the snapshot. Reload mechanics and rollback steps are documented on the internal page.

— Tomas

runbook for tafof-yawif: https://confluence.tolvaqsys.internal/display/display/browse/pages/7be3

Plugin authors extending the Gridmere CSV import wizard must package their parsers through the Hollyvale bundler. Each bundle is validated against the column-mapping spec, then signed before the wizard will load it in a tenant workspace. Unsigned bundles are silently ignored. For sandbox testing, sign with the shared development key shown directly below.

deploy key for kajof-yawif: bky9_fvxrpdHPq